以太坊的EVM (Ehereum Virual Machie)是让智能合约能够在以太坊网络中运行的重要组件。EVM是一款基于账户的开源虚拟机,它模拟了能够运行智能合约的硬件级计算机环境。
EVM的主要特征如下。
1.编程语言支持:EVM支持多种编程语言,如Solidiy、Vyper等,设计便于编写和理解,同时满足智能合约的需求。是。
2.图灵完备性:EVM具有图灵完备性,可以执行图灵机能够执行的任何计算。这样一来,智能合约就能灵活地实现复杂的逻辑。
3.模块化设计:EVM的各个组件都是模块化的,这有助于提高其安全性和可维护性。EVM还支持插件的开发和使用,进一步提高了灵活性和可扩展性。
4 .跨链功能:EVM包含不同的区块链?还有跨链功能,可以实现网络之间的智能合约交易。由此,以太坊?网络是其他区块链?与网络的相互运用成为可能,应用范围扩大。
以太坊?EVM构成网络的核心,为智能合约的执行提供必要的环境和条件。以太坊?网络通过EVM可以支持更丰富、更复杂的应用场景。